How Often You Should Schedule The Professional Manual for air duct cleaning services dallas

The frequency of duct cleaning depends on several factors, including the presence of pets, smoking habits, and the overall air quality in your home. As a general guideline, it is recommended to schedule The Professional Manual for air duct cleaning services dallas every 3 to 5 years. However, if you've recently renovated, experienced a flood, or suspect mold growth, you should consider more frequent cleaning. Choosing the Right The Professional Manual for air duct cleaning services dallas Service in the US

When selecting a duct cleaning service, research is key. Look for a company with certified technicians, positive customer reviews, and transparent pricing. Ensure they use professional-grade equipment and follow industry best practices. Ask about their cleaning process and what it entails, including inspection, cleaning methods, and post-cleaning verification.
